One type of congenital heart defect is called atrial septal defect (ASD) where the left and right atria are not completely separated. ASD usually results in blood moving from the left atrium into the right atrium. This will cause increased blood pressure in the right atrium and decreased blood pressure in the left atrium. Explanation
As the left atrium has oxygenated blood and the right has deoxygenated blood, as blood moves to the right atrium % oxygen will increase in the right atrium and so in the right ventricle and pulmonary artery as well (as that's the blood pathway). Since the right atrium has more blood and hence a higher blood pressure, more blood will enter the right ventricle and so the pulmonary artery as well, increasing pressure in both. The same would happen to the left side, as less blood is present in the left atrium, and less blood will enter the ventricle and the systemic aorta, decreasing the pressure in both, so option D is correct as it is the only option with the right combination.
